Tactical Fitness 40+ Options (book, ebook, Amazon)

In the tactical professions, fitness can be the difference between life and death and we will be older for a longer period of time than we were younger. Learning how to progress into those decades smartly with added longevity training - typically in the form of active recovery days and mobility days is going to increase your abilities and decrease your pain. Motivation Can Grow into Mental Toughness

Over the past several years of writing about high level Special Ops Fitness, there is always a question concerning Mental Toughness.  I get asked if I have any tips on getting more mentally tough.  And I hate to sound like a grumpy, old coach, but to answer that – THERE ARE NO TIPS!  There is no secret sauce that makes mental toughness magically appear in your life.  Mental Toughness is built slowly – sometimes years – over several stages.  Here is how I see mental toughness and resilience develop over time in the following stages: Motivation – There is a...
